6100 Series
6100- Unable to establish the TCP connection with the instrument.
Cause: A communications problem between the computer and the analyzer
has occurred.
Action A: Check the cable connection between the computer and the analyzer.
Action B: Select Unit [n] > Unit
Configuration from the main menu and verify
that the TCP/IP configuration for the computer and the analyzer are
correct.
Action C: Exit the 2460 application and turn off th
e analyzer. Then turn on the
analyzer and restart the 2460 application. If the problem persists, con-
tact your Micromeritics representative.
6101- Configured serial number does not match instrument.
Cause: The serial number of the instrument is different than the serial number
the application expects.
Action: Run the setup program on the installation CD; choose the Re
move
operation to remove the incorrect serial number. Then choose the Add
operation to add the correct serial number.
6102- The instrument (unit number) is not calibrated.
Cause: One or more calibration operations have not been performed.
Action: If using the setup CD, reinstall the calibrati
on files. If this does not cor-
rect the problem, contact your Micromeritics representative.
